Author: toad
Date: 2006-11-08 20:27:23 +0000 (Wed, 08 Nov 2006)
New Revision: 10837
Modified:
trunk/freenet/src/freenet/client/async/ClientRequestScheduler.java
Log:
Fix the "lowering priority doesn't work" bug.
Modified: trunk/freenet/src/freenet/client/async/ClientRequestScheduler.java
===================================================================
--- trunk/freenet/src/freenet/client/async/ClientRequestScheduler.java
2006-11-08 20:16:03 UTC (rev 10836)
+++ trunk/freenet/src/freenet/client/async/ClientRequestScheduler.java
2006-11-08 20:27:23 UTC (rev 10837)
@@ -293,7 +293,7 @@
if(req == null) {
if(logMINOR) Logger.minor(this, "No
requests, adjusted retrycount "+rga.getNumber()+" ("+rga+")");
break;
- }else if(req.getPriorityClass() >
choosenPriorityClass) {
+ } else if(req.getPriorityClass() !=
choosenPriorityClass) {
// Reinsert it : shouldn't happen if we
are calling reregisterAll,
// maybe we should ask people to report
that error if seen
if(logMINOR) Logger.minor(this, "In
wrong priority class: "+req);